英文摘要
We produced a new type of velocity decelerator which is constructed with 200sets of asymmetrically spatial modulated magnetic fields by using neodymium magnets. For the performance examination of the designed decelerator, we studied the action of the velocity decelerator on the metastable He(3S). The velocity distribution of He(3S) after passing the velocity modulator separates into three components, which correspond to the three different magnetic quantum number(M) states. It is verified that we succeeded in the state selection of the paramagnetic species by deceleration and acceleration of the velocity depending on the quantum state.
